Comicastudy Regular for Brand Identity and Logo Design

Comicastudy Regular is a display font with a distinct personality. Its rounded edges and soft curves give it a friendly, almost hand-drawn feel. When I tested it on a logo draft, it added a sense of warmth and accessibility that other more rigid fonts lacked. It worked well as a headline font, especially for a brand targeting a younger, more casual audience.

The font’s versatility shone through in different applications. On a business card, it stood out without being overwhelming. In a logo, it felt just right—neither too bold nor too delicate. It’s the kind of font that can anchor a brand identity while still allowing other elements to breathe.

Comicastudy Regular for Web Headers and Social Media Graphics

Testing Comicastudy Regular on a website header gave me a clear sense of its strengths. It looked clean and readable at larger sizes, making it perfect for headlines or call-to-action buttons. On social media, it caught the eye without being distracting. It worked well on Instagram posts and Facebook banners, adding a touch of personality to digital content.

One thing to note is that while it’s great for short phrases, it may not be the best choice for long blocks of text. For web design, it’s best used sparingly—either as a headline or as an accent to other fonts.

Comicastudy Regular for Creative Studio Branding and Print Assets

In a recent creative studio branding project, I used Comicastudy Regular for a poster and flyer. The font brought a sense of energy and creativity to the designs. It paired well with a simple sans serif for body text, creating a balanced and cohesive look. The contrast between the two fonts helped guide the viewer’s eye and add visual interest.

For print assets like business cards and flyers, Comicastudy Regular held up well. It had enough detail to feel unique but wasn’t so ornate that it lost clarity. It’s a good example of a display font that can work across multiple formats without losing its charm.
